About

Long Zhao is a scholar working on Control and Systems Engineering, Civil and Structural Engineering and Mechanical Engineering. According to data from OpenAlex, Long Zhao has authored 56 papers receiving a total of 350 indexed citations (citations by other indexed papers that have themselves been cited), including 36 papers in Control and Systems Engineering, 21 papers in Civil and Structural Engineering and 14 papers in Mechanical Engineering. Recurrent topics in Long Zhao's work include Vibration and Dynamic Analysis (22 papers), Thermal Analysis in Power Transmission (16 papers) and Structural Health Monitoring Techniques (15 papers). Long Zhao is often cited by papers focused on Vibration and Dynamic Analysis (22 papers), Thermal Analysis in Power Transmission (16 papers) and Structural Health Monitoring Techniques (15 papers). Long Zhao collaborates with scholars based in China, United States and India. Long Zhao's co-authors include Xinbo Huang, Ye Zhang, Jianyuan Jia, Yu Zhao, Yi Tian, Ziliang Chen, Cheng Liu, Guimin Chen, Chao Zhu and Hao Yang and has published in prestigious journals such as IEEE Access, Sensors and Energies.
